目的收集以植物作为生物反应器生产药用/工业用产品的数据信息,构建药用/工业用转基因植物数据库。方法收集药用/工业用转基因植物相关资料,每个转化事件收集包括外源蛋白表达量、毒性、致敏性、临床数据、安全等级在内的20多种信息。利用Linux.Apache Mysql PHP(LAMP)架构首次设计药用/工业用转基因植物数据库,面向用户不同需求设计初级检索和高级检索两种检索方式。结果本研究成功构建了药用/工业用转基因植物数据库。目前,收集了300多份数据信息,整理了转化事件近200条,完成信息上传108条,并将定期更新。结论该数据库具有综合性、专业性、实用性和首创性的特点,为药用/工业用转基因植物新品种的研发提供信息帮助,为政府机构审批和监管以及制定其安全评价标准提供技术支撑。
Objective To construct the database of pharmaceutical and industrial transgenic plants, the research group collected published data related with genetically modified (GM) plants as bioreactors. Methods Collect information associated with GM plants. Every GM event contains more than 20 parameters including the expression of exogenous protein, toxicity, allergenicity, clinical data and security level, etc. The database was designed with Linux Apache Mysql PHP (LAMP) and two kinds of retrieval modes, primary retrieval method and advanced retrieval method, were realized for different users. Results In this study, the database of pharmaceutical and industrial transgenic plants was constructed successfully. Presently, we collected more than 300 published data related with GM plants as bioreactors, compiled 200 GM events approximately and uploaded 108 GM events of the information. Conclusion The database is characterized by comprehensiveness, specialty, practicability and innovation, providing information resources for new GM plant varieties development and technological support for government to formulate regulations, approve and supervise pharmaceutical and industrial GM plants.
